We are actively seeking an experiencedSeniorStaffProduct Managerto join ourHigh-Throughput Platforms this key role you will drive product strategy definition and cross-functional execution for a major next-phase platform initiative within Illuminas high-throughput sequencing portfolio.

This position is ideal for a seasoned product leader with deep experience in Next-Generation Sequencing who can connect customer workflows technology capabilities and sequencing economics to guide complex multi-year platform programs. You will collaborate across R&D Operations Commercial and strategic partners to help deliver the next wave of innovation in high-throughput sequencinggrounded in a clear customer-first perspective.It is critical thatyou think beyond the sequencer and developproductstrategies that meetcustomerneeds in emerging high intensity sequencing applications.

Responsibilities

  • Provide product leadership for a complex multi-year platform program including business case framing customer and market analysis requirements definition and strategic decision support.

  • Lead market input to design decisions by understanding workflow needs application requirements competitive trends and ecosystem dynamics (library prep automation informatics).

  • Represent the customer as a critical member of thedevelopmentcore team byadvocating fortheir needs andensuring trade off decisions do notimpactIlluminas ability to serve our customers.

  • Engage directly with high-throughput customersgenome centers clinical labs research institutes and service providersto bring a deep workflow-informed voice ofcustomerinto product strategy and development.

  • Anchor product decisions in a customer-first understanding of operational constraints workflow bottlenecks application needs andadoptiondrivers.

  • Partner closely with R&D teams to translate customer needs and workflow insights into clear testable product requirements and acceptance criteria.

  • Drive cross-functional execution across chemistry hardware software operations and commercial stakeholders to ensure program alignment and readiness.

  • Support cross-functional teams in modeling adoption patterns sequencing volume drivers workflow considerations and platform economics to inform platform and portfolio decisions.

  • Collaborate with Regional Marketing Product Management and the Commercial Organization toalign onmessaging positioning launch plans and customer engagement strategies.

  • Develop clear materials and frameworks to support executive decision-making including product trade-offs opportunity assessments and roadmap recommendations.

  • Work with commercial teams to create and deliver sales tools positioning guidance objection handling and customer-facing content.

  • Build strong relationships with internal and external partners key opinion leaders and ecosystem stakeholders to stay ahead of emergingcustomerand technology trends.

  • Represent the platform strategy across internal teams and drive clarity on product direction customer value and business impact.

Requirements

  • Typically requires a minimum of 12 years of related experience with a Bachelors degree; or 12 years and a Masters degree; or a PhD with 8 years of experience; or equivalent experience

  • Strong technical knowledge of NGS platforms workflows and high-throughput sequencing applications.

  • Demonstratedability to integrate customer insights technical constraints and business drivers into clear product strategy and requirements.

  • Demonstratedability tooperateas a customer-first product leader grounding product decisions in real customer workflows technical realities and long-term adoption dynamics.

  • Experience working in highly cross-functional matrixed environments with R&D Operations Finance and Commercial teams.

  • Proven analytical strength with the ability to interpret complex data modelbusinesses casesand link analysis to strategic decisions.

  • Strong communicationand executive-level presentation skills.

  • Experience supporting or launching products in clinical genomics high-throughput research or sequencing operations is highly desirable.

  • Demonstratedunderstanding of ecosystem dependencies (workflow integration automation informatics samplelogistics) and how they influence customer adoption.

  • Up to30%travelmay be.
